                                                                     Fairtrade business lunch to promote
                                                                          better deal for the less well off

                                         Sunday School and Creche  Local businesses and schools are being urged by the Swindon Fairtrade
                                                                   Coalition to stock or use Fairtrade products to make a difference to the

                                                 Community School  life chances of the world’s poor.
                                                                     To help get the message across the coalition is holding a Fairtrade
                                                                   Business lunch on Thursday 28 October, 12.30pm to 1.30pm at St Jo-
                                                                   seph’s College hosted by the Mayor of Swindon and Lord Joel Joffe, a
                                                                   founder of Oxfam.
                                                                     Attendees will be treated to a Fairtrade lunch served by local cater-
                                                                   ers and listen to Ben Speed of the Fairtrade Foundation talking about
                                                                   the benefi ts of Fairtrade for businesses and how making a commitment
                                                                   directly helps the farmers who grow the foodstuffs.
                                                                     The event is by ticket only. To attend call Barbara Aftelak on 536815
                                                                   by 7 October or mail: [email protected]
